  • What a let down!

    The Last Kingdom had been a fantastic series - however this film has not been of the same standard.

    The story is sketchy, jumping from scene to scene without a constant flow. It seems to me they have tried to fit too much into the time allowed.

    Whereas the series had time to build up tension and develop characters, this feels rushed, the direction clumsy and sometimes disjointed.

    It's further spoiled by continuous very loud background music which detracts from the story and is actually annoying.

    It does have its moments, the last half being better than the first half, but is not as enjoyable as it was, feeling somewhat repetitious.

    I had been looking forward to this film but was sadly disappointed.
